[0002] Due to the characteristics of punctuality, fast speed, large commuting volume and low-carbon environmental protection, the subway is used by many domestic and foreign cities to effectively alleviate urban congestion and environmental problems. People are paying more and more attention to it, but the research on the comfort and health of subway passengers mostly focuses on the analysis of a single variable or a single variable such as the vibration signal of the subway train, the environment inside the car, and human physiology, and there is no comprehensive subway train operation. Information, compartment environmental information and human physiological information wearable subway passenger comfort and health evaluation equipment and methods; the existing subway comfort measurement equipment mainly takes train vibration as the measurement target, and relies on the GB5599-85 measurement specification and UIC513 standard for subway Train comfort evaluation, the equipment is not portable, has a single function and is expensive. It only evaluates the influence of subway car vibration on the comfort of subway passengers unilaterally, without considering the influence of environmental factors and passenger physiological parameters on the comfort of subway passengers; however, the existing Studies have shown that environmental factors in the train (such as noise, temperature, humidity, air pressure, etc.) and passenger physiological parameters (such as heart rate, pulse blood, oxygen saturation, blood pressure, body temperature, etc.) play a crucial role in the evaluation of passenger comfort.
[0003] At this stage, measurement equipment that can be used for subway passenger comfort and health evaluation, subway operation problem monitoring, and human health tracking has a single function and is not portable. There is no wearable device that can integrate the above three functions

Embodiment Construction

[0013] see figure 1 Schematic diagram of wearable subway passenger comfort and health intelligent perception bracelet, multi-sensory flexible electronic skin 1 adopts integrated design and installation, and integrates attitude sensor, light sensor, temperature and humidity sensor, air pressure altitude sensor, noise monitoring sensor, Beidou chip, semiconductor Air quality sensor, photoelectric pulse sensor and body temperature sensor are integrated together.

[0014] see figure 2 Schematic diagram of wearable subway passenger comfort and health intelligent perception wristband. The upper surface of the multi-sensory flexible electronic skin is also equipped with a display screen 2, which is used to display the train running position, time, altitude, passenger comfort and health evaluation results, and text prompts.

Abstract

The invention discloses a wearable smart sensing bracelet for the comfort degree and health of passengers in a subway. The bracelet structurally comprises a multi-sensory flexible electronic skin, a data processing module and a data display module, and a beidou chip, a posture sensor, an illumination sensor, a gas pressure sensor, a temperature and humidity sensor, a noise monitoring sensor, an air quality sensor, a photoelectric pulse sensor and a body temperature sensor are integrated on the multi-sensory flexible electronic skin, so that multivariable signals are collected; the signals areamplified, filtered, subjected to noise reduction and fused through the data processing module, and the evaluation results of the comfort degree and the health of the passengers in the subway are displayed on the data display module; collecting data and the results can be stored in the data processing module and are transmitted into a mobile terminal or a desktop computer through wireless communication and USB serial port communication to be displayed and stored. With the bracelet, the comfort degree and health conditions of the passengers in the subway can be comprehensively and accurately evaluated; the bracelet is used for monitoring subway operation and tracking the health conditions of a human body, is convenient to operate and high in reliability, and has good market prospects.
